Crear un cursor a partir de un formulario

Soy muevo en VFP 6. Mi problema es el siguiente. Necesito crear un informe con algunos datos sacados de un formulario; es decir, en el formulario el usuario registra los datos en los cuadros de texto y luego necesito usar algunos de éstos para hacer un informe (que dicho sea de paso toma los otros datos de una tabla creada con un SELECT - SQL Command).
Entiendo que ésto se puede hacer creando un cursor con los datos del formulario y luego usando dicho cursor como origen de los datos (junto con los que provienen de la tabla) para el informe; sin embargo, no se cómo hacerlo. Me puedes ayudar con un ejemplo. Gracias de antemano
Saludos

2 respuestas

Respuesta
1
Otra manera sencilla de hacer eso es creando variables publicas por cada campo en el formulario y después desde el reporte solo pones el nombre de esas variables publicas y las imprimirá e incluso podrás hacer cálculos con esas variables, recuerda poner en el evento destroy del formulario el RELEASE para cada variable que creaste como publica
formulario_init()
PUBLIC VARIABLE1
formulario_destroy()
Release variable1
Respuesta
1
Antes de ejecutar el select, asignas los valores del formulario a variables y luegos los utilizas, por ejemplo
Local lcNombre
lcNombre=thisform.txtcNombre.value
select tabla.campo1,tabla.campo2,lcnombre as cnombre from tabla into cursor micursor

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as